WebOct 24, 2013 · In order to display the genotype for each, geneticists use shorthand. When referring to a gene, + means the wildtype, which is the "normal" version, and - means that the gene is missing, often a knockout. So a typical individual's genome for a particular gene will be +/+, a hemizygote (one copy deleted) is +/-, and a complete knockout is -/-.
